Output 8aaf66acd7bf20c8ba08bbd2ff6c15dedff1f3b2d990492c0316dd7e6aa63104:124
- value
- 10963260
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d607ec0e225f1e50c9554dc82a27a0a1a9e89ef
- address
- bc1q94s8as8zyhc72ry42nwg9gn6pgdfaz00qz50y2
- transaction
- 8aaf66acd7bf20c8ba08bbd2ff6c15dedff1f3b2d990492c0316dd7e6aa63104